Transaction 2c4527709b892305d20397a42bdef07a9820b4e3606af6b21a861b13b61a2737
1 Input
2 Outputs
- 2c4527709b892305d20397a42bdef07a9820b4e3606af6b21a861b13b61a2737:0
- 2c4527709b892305d20397a42bdef07a9820b4e3606af6b21a861b13b61a2737:1
value 4300000
address 14L4bL5aLDkX1SwJsqmZgKg2W52YcaMYRX
value 43886874
address 17CvuJDK6mm2PRpWTp9xwUrhTYXtatvbA